在数字化时代,服务器的角色愈发重要,它们不仅是互联网的基石,还承担着许多关键任务。无论是在大型企业、云计算服务,还是个人项目中,理解服务器的功能和应用都是至关重要的。
一、什么是服务器?
服务器是一种计算机系统,它的主要功能是提供资源、数据、服务或程序给其他计算机(我们称之为“客户端”)使用。与普通个人电脑不同,服务器通常具备更高的性能、可扩展性和可靠性。它们可以以物理形式存在,也可以通过虚拟化技术运行在云环境中。
二、服务器的类型
服务器有多种类型,每一种都有其独特的功能。
Web服务器 Web服务器的主要功能是存储和传输网站内容。当用户在浏览器里输入网址时,Web服务器响应请求,并将网页内容传送给用户的设备。
数据库服务器 数据库服务器负责存储、管理和检索数据。它们通过数据库管理系统(DBMS)与客户端进行交互,确保数据的安全性和完整性。
文件服务器 文件服务器用于存储和管理用户文件,允许多个用户共享文件和打印机。这对于企业来说尤其重要,可以集中管理数据和资源。
应用服务器 应用服务器负责执行和管理后台应用程序,它们处理客户端请求并返回结果。这种类型的服务器通常在复杂的企业环境中使用。
邮件服务器 邮件服务器负责发送、接收和存储电子邮件。它们确保信息的迅速传递和安全存储,确保用户的邮件通信畅通无阻。
三、服务器的功能
服务器具备许多重要功能,使其成为现代网络架构中不可或缺的元素。
数据存储与管理 服务器可以保存大规模的数据,以便于随时访问。这种集中管理的数据方式减少了数据冗余,提高了数据安全性。
处理能力 服务器的处理能力往往超过普通个人电脑,能够同时处理多个请求和任务。这使得它们能够支持高负载的应用。
网络共享 服务器让多用户能够通过网络访问共用资源,例如文件、应用程序和设备。这种协作方式提高了工作效率。
远程访问 许多服务器支持远程访问,使得用户可以通过互联网随时随地访问数据和应用程序。这在远程办公和移动工作中非常重要。
四、如何选择服务器?
选择适合的服务器取决于多种因素,包括预算、预期负载、使用场景等。
性能需求 根据所需处理的工作量,选择适当的CPU和内存配置。对于高流量网站或大型数据库,建议采用高性能服务器。
存储类型 SSD(固态硬盘)和HDD(机械硬盘)各有优缺点,SSD在速度上更具优势,而HDD在大容量存储方面更为经济。
扩展性 选择能够方便扩展的服务器型号,以应对未来可能的业务增长。云服务器通常具备高扩展性,适合动态需求。
安全性 服务器的安全性至关重要。选择有良好安全特性和支持的服务器,以保护敏感数据。
五、服务器的管理与维护
有效的服务器管理和维护能够延长服务器的使用寿命,并保证其稳定性。
监控与优化 定期监控服务器性能,以识别潜在问题并进行优化。这包括检查CPU使用率、内存使用情况和网络流量等。
定期备份 定期备份数据,确保在数据丢失或损坏时能够快速恢复。这对于任何企业或个人用户来说都是非常重要的。
更新与升级 随着技术的发展,定期更新操作系统和应用程序,确保服务器能够抵御安全威胁和性能瓶颈。
六、未来发展趋势
随着技术的进步,服务器的功能与应用也在不断演变。
云服务器的普及 越来越多的企业选择云服务器,因其灵活性和可扩展性,这使得资源管理更加高效。
边缘计算 在物联网(IoT)时代,边缘计算开始崭露头角,服务器被部署在离数据源更近的位置,以减少延迟和提高处理效率。
人工智能的集成 未来服务器将越来越多地集成人工智能技术,以提升自动化管理与数据处理能力,这是技术发展的重要趋势。
理解服务器的功能和应用,可以帮助个人和企业更有效地利用资源,实现更好的业务发展。随着数字化进程的加速,服务器将继续在数据处理、存储和协作等方面发挥核心作用。